I have decided to join together my various interests, activities and offerings under one heading in this website, namely: Sue Hughes Values Living.
Yes, I do value living, and yes, I endorse fully living my own values.
My background is as a musician, and I am still fully engaged in this as a teacher and composer; I also enjoy making music, currently primarily as a member of a choir (The Sheffield Chorale), and accompanying students in their exams and other performances.
I have always loved language and enjoy using words to their fullest potential. In my songwriting I enjoy often writing my own lyrics and this has led to writing poetry for its own sake. Prose writing has followed on with the creation of two blogs. The act of writing these short articles has stimulated me to start The Great Amalgamation – putting together teaching, writing, performance and coaching skills to provide a variety of services.
Coaching has come about through my teaching, but also through illness. A few years ago I was laid low by Chronic Fatigue Syndrome. My recovery from that led me along unplanned paths, but it resulted in training as a practitioner in those modalities that aided my own reentry into Life.
It is very rewarding for me to be able to work alongside someone as they start to live their own values and achieve their own goals. This can be in many guises, direct or indirect. Directly, through personal coaching or writing to commission; indirectly, through written offerings or the listening to my music.
My current joyful, fallible, creative existence is enhanced by my beloved family. I am an inordinately proud mother and grandmother and live with my long suffering husband and terrier.
I use the following modalities in my coaching work, in which I am certified:- Life Coaching, Hypnotherapy, Neurolinguistic Programming (NLP), Emotional Freedom Techniques (EFT), Simple Energy Techniques (SET), Provocative Energy Techniques (PET), Intention Tapping (IEP). I am a supervisor/mentor on Steve Wells’s IEP training courses.
I am fully insured and registered with Data Protection.
I have a Music Degree from Reading University (BA) and a piano teaching diploma from the Royal College of Music (ARCM). I am a member of the Incorporated Society of Musicians and have been teaching for 35 years.
My music composition is eclectic and includes children’s musicals and other songs. Currently most of my output is choral, both sacred and secular.
I have secretarial skills and qualifications and have worked as a concerts manager and in other administrative posts. I also have considerable experience in editing.
